During medical decision making, under the category for Amount and/or Complexity of Data Reviewed, credit can be given for "Review and summarization of old records. What exactly falls into the category of "old records"?
Example: If my GI doc sees a patient in follow up and lists colon last year under the past medical history portion and then summarizes the findings, does this count as "old records reviewed/summarized"? What if that colonoscopy was performed a week or two ago?
